The main purpose of this study is to investigate behaviors of mobile phone use and mobile phone addiction tendency of senior and vocational high school students in Keelung city. The survey is conducted using questionnaires, based on stratified cluster sampling. The subjects are high school students from 8 public high schools in Keelung city, with an effective sample size of 927 students. The conclusion of the research findings is as follows, 1. The most used functions of mobile phones are for entertainment and social networks. 2. There was no significant difference of mobile phone addiction tendency between different grades. 3. Mobile Phone Addiction Tendency: A high school student with a smartphone is more likely to become addicted to his/her mobile phone. 4. Moreover, subjects will have a higher possibility of mobile phone addiction tendency the longer they use their mobile phone each day. 5. High school students in the largest degree of mobile phone addiction is "warning level," accounting for 68.3%. In concluding the above survey, the researcher has derived conclusions and presented advice to educational institutions and for future research as a reference to prevent high school students from mobile phone addiction.
